Timon Gehr is a scholar working on Artificial Intelligence, Computer Vision and Pattern Recognition and Electrical and Electronic Engineering. According to data from OpenAlex, Timon Gehr has authored 12 papers receiving a total of 729 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Artificial Intelligence, 4 papers in Computer Vision and Pattern Recognition and 1 paper in Electrical and Electronic Engineering. Recurrent topics in Timon Gehr’s work include Adversarial Robustness in Machine Learning (7 papers), Advanced Neural Network Applications (4 papers) and Machine Learning and Algorithms (2 papers). Timon Gehr is often cited by papers focused on Adversarial Robustness in Machine Learning (7 papers), Advanced Neural Network Applications (4 papers) and Machine Learning and Algorithms (2 papers). Timon Gehr collaborates with scholars based in Switzerland, United States and Bulgaria. Timon Gehr's co-authors include Martin Vechev, Matthew Mirman, Gagandeep Singh, Markus Püschel, Dana Drachsler-Cohen, Petar Tsankov, Swarat Chaudhuri, Mislav Balunović, Benjamin Bichsel and Ce Zhang and has published in prestigious journals such as ACM SIGPLAN Notices, Proceedings of the ACM on Programming Languages and arXiv (Cornell University).
